Frankie does it again! This is the second book in the Drowned Empire series and it had me in a chokehold! The first 15-20% was a little hard for me to focus on but there were a lot of outside factors keeping my attention when I began this book. After that I couldn’t part with it. This book starts off exactly where book 1 ends, so there are no missing gaps that you need to be filled in on. I feel like she did a really good job refreshing peoples memories of things that happened in DDE (book 1) so it isn’t entirely necessary for you to do a re-read of DDE. The development of Lyr’s character.. I’m here for it. The slow burn between Rhyan and Lyr.. here for it. There was the twist about who Lyr REALLY is, but there was plenty of foreshadowing that it wasn’t entirely a twist. The twist with who was actually leading the Emartis however.. WHAT?!?! I do not appreciate Mercurial being a sneaky sneak. I had high hopes that he was really good just trying to help Lyr realize her destiny, but tricking her into making a deal makes me feel like he’s not really a good guy. Guess we will have to wait til book 3 to get a better feel for him. Overall, I will be chasing the feels this book gave me probably until book 3 is released. AMAZING!!!.
